Blackberry Cobbler

Ingredients
- Dough Ingredients:
- 1/2 cup milk
- 3/4 cup flour
- 2 teaspoons baking powder
- 1/2 cup sugar
- 1/2 stick butter
- Berries:
- 1/2 cup sugar
- 2 cups blackberries
Details
Servings 6
Preparation
Step 1
Mix all dough ingredients.
Melt butter in baking dish, pour onto dough mix.
Sweeten berries to taste, pour onto dough mix.
Put into 350° oven and bake until crust is brown.
